Description
Set in a favoured location, just two miles from the historic town of Battle, this Grade II listed double fronted period property presents a rate opportunity to acquire a home of character with lots of potential to be sympathetically restored. The property offers generous accommodation laid out over two floors with four well proportioned bedrooms and three reception rooms, two enjoying bay windows looking out to the front garden. Whilst in need of comprehensive improvements, the house provides an exceptional opportunity to personalise a home in a desirable location. Externally the property is set within established formal gardens that do currently require attention, but have historically been extensively planted. A driveway provides ample parking and leads to a cluster of outbuildings includes a Nissan hut, block built barn, stable complex and separate timber barn, all offering potential and in need of improvement.

OUTSIDE
The property is approached through a 5 bar gate that leads into a driveway providing ample parking with access to the outbuildings. A farm gate leads into the field and a separate pedestrian gate leads to the side garden. In addition a pedestrian gate leads directly to the front of the property with established gardens that wrap around providing a good deal of privacy, being extensively planted with specimen trees and shrubs, all somewhat overgrown, interspersed with areas of lawn. To the rear the house overhangs a seating area that looks out onto the rear gardens with a lawn interspersed with specimen trees and a 5 bar gate leading to a small paddock enclosure.
THE OUTBUILDINGS COMPRISE
NISSAN HUT 13' 2" x 18' 0" (4.01m x 5.49m) to the side is BLOCK BUILT BARN 31' 4" x 17' 4" (9.55m x 5.28m). A walk way has double gates leading to the paddock and opens to a BLOCK AND TIMBER BUILT BARN 13' 8" x 17' 10" (4.17m x 5.44m) which has been sub-divided to create 4 small stables with hay barn area. Beyond the barns is a block work muck heap and an additional TIMBER BARN 19' 9" x 15' 0" (6.02m x 4.57m) partially sub-divided and open fronted into the field. The barns adjoin the main field which is sub-divided with established borders, laid to pasture grazing and totalling approx. 3 acres.
